Farkle is another free and fun game on Facebook.com. Playing the free game will eventually unlock Pro level for online competitions with other players.
Facebook.com has many great games to play online. Farkle is a dice based game that is similar to Yahtzee. Five dice are thrown and certain combinations earn points. The vast difference in Farkle is that if none of those combinations show up on each toss, any points not “banked” are lost. Three Farkles in a row is an additional 500 points subtracted from total score. So the trick is to make sure to bank points after one or two Farkles to avoid that dreaded third Farkle. Tricks of Farkle : the GameThere are a few tricks to keep in mind while playing the game. The one dice earns a hundred points but a five only earns fifty. It’s usually a good idea to only select the ones unless there are at least three of the fives. That actually goes for all the dice. Any three of them gives the player more points. For instance 3 of the fives earns 500 points, 3 of the fours earns 400 and 3 of the twos earns 200. One is the only exception. If 3 of those are thrown, 1,000 points is earned. If 4 of the same number were thrown, then that amount would be doubled. So if 4 twos were thrown, it would be 400 points. If 5 twos were thrown, 600. There are other combinations, such as 3 pairs of any numbered dice earns 750 in one toss, and 1 through 5 earns 1,500. See screenshot for more detail (link to game is above pic). Dice can continue to be thrown until either the player banks the points earned or gets a Farkle. Farkle is Fun and Frustrating GamblingThe game is both fun and frustrating, since it involves gambling. At least one points-earning dice has to be held in order to throw the rest. Once at least 300 points have been earned, clicking on the total in the left column will bank them. The gambling part is trying to get the points of each of the 10 rounds as high as they can go before getting a Farkle. What is a Farkle? It’s when a throw results in no dice that has earned points. For instance if three dice are thrown and they are 2 twos and a 4, that would be a Farkle. Any points not banked would then be lost, and the next round would begin. Play Farkle Solo or in CompetitionThis game can be played by itself, or player can compete with other friends. There is also a Pro level where a live game can be played with other people on Facebook. The Pro version takes either 10,000 chips or $9.99. How are the chips earned? Well, 25 chips are awarded at the end of every game up to 150 a day. Friends can also give others friends 100 chips a day. There are even offers with other companies to earn chips. It just depends on how fast the player wants to make Pro without having to pay for it. The disadvantage of playing the basic version is that ads are played after about three games of Farkle. It’s not too bad since they can be skipped a few seconds into the ad, and then player is taken to a new game. It's a small inconvenience for being able to play such a fun free game.
